The answer & Explanation

1. (C) But also is used in correlation with the inclusive not only. Choice (B) would be

used in correlation with both. Choices (A) and (D) are not used in correlation with

another inclusive.

2. (D) In order to refer to an increase in the rate of inflation, rises should be used. To

raise means to move to a higher place. To rise means to increase.

3. (B) Ideas after exclusives should be expressed by parallel structures. To hunt

should be in hunting to provide for parallelism with the phrase in planting.

4. (A) Because is used before a subject and verb to introduce cause. Choices (B),

(C), and (D) are not accepted for statements of cause.

5. (B) Form should be formation. Although both are nouns derived from verbs, the –

ation ending is needed here. Form means the structure. Formation means the

process of forming over time.

6. (A) Ideas in a series should expressed by parallel structures. Only to sell in

choice (A) provides for parallelism with the infinitive to increase. Choices (B), (C),

and (D) are not parallel.

7. (C) Ideas in a series should be expressed by parallel structures. It is should be

deleted to provide for parallelism with the adjectives interesting, informative, and

easy.

8. (D) In contrary-to-fact clauses, were is the only accepted form of the verb BE.

Choices (A), (B), and (C) are forms of the verb BE, but they are not accepted in

contrary-to-fact clauses.
9. (A) A verb word must be used in a clause after an impersonal expression. It not

should be not be after the impersonal expression it is essential.

10. (B) Only choice (B) may be used with a uncountable noun such as money.

Choices (A), (C), and (D) may be used with Countable nouns.
